France’s minister for equal rights, Elisabeth Moreno, said that reports of domestic violence registered with the government rose 42% during France’s first virus lockdown in the spring, and have risen 15% since a new lockdown was imposed nearly a month ago. The charity Refuge said the number of people calling its domestic abuse hotline were 65% higher between April and June than in the first three months of the year, before lockdown. The Italian Health Ministry, citing data from national statistics agency ISTAT, said calls to domestic violence hotlines shot up during the lockdown, registering a 75% increase compared to the same period in 2019. Before the pandemic, it is estimated that 243 million women and girls (aged 15-49) across the … In Britain, The Office for National Statistics said police recorded 259,324 domestic abuse offenses between March and June, an increase of 18% compared to the same period in 2018. “These appalling statistics show endemic levels of domestic abuse,” Labour Party crime spokesman Nick Thomas-Symonds said. The number of reports might be higher, however, as lockdown restrictions make reporting more difficult. In Turkey, where at least 234 women were killed since the start of the year, according to government figures, riot police in Istanbul blocked a small group of demonstrators from marching to the city’s iconic Taksim Square to denounce violence against women.
